Clinical Overview

Dr. Lalaine Ramirez-Hom, MD works in Effingham, IL as an Internist and has 37 years experience.

Dr. Ramirez-Hom is board certified in Internal Medicine and graduated from UNIVERSITY OF THE CITY OF MANILA / COLLEGE OF MEDICINE in 1989. Dr. Ramirez-Hom is affiliated with HSHS St. Anthony's Memorial Hospital. Dr. Ramirez-Hom is accepting new patients.

What’s a board certification and why is it important that my provider has one?

A board certification represents a provider’s dedication to ongoing training in one or more specialties, including the completion of intensive exams. While not all specialties have board certifications, if your provider does have one they’ve taken the extra step to master their specialty and to keep up with the latest advancements in their field.
